Kenmore First Friday is back with fresh musicians, vendor markets and breweries in 2022!

Kenmore Neighborhood Alliance in partnership with Akron Civic Commons and Rotary Club of Akron are excited to announce the return of Kenmore First Fridays to the historic Kenmore Boulevard business district. The events will kick off June 3 with live music from the energetic honky-tonk group The Shootouts, whose third album, “Stampede,” is being produced by 10-time Grammy Award winner Ray Benson. The album will also feature special guest appearances from country legend Marty Stuart, Buddy Miller and their touring partners, Asleep at The Wheel.

Joining The Shootouts on the main stage will be local favorites and self-proclaimed “fun band” Akronauts, and additional live music will be programmed by Akron Recording Company and the youth-based nonprofit First Glance’s hip-hop program and will be sponsored by Cargill and Kenmore Chamber of Commerce. In addition, Oddmall’s “The Great Grassman Gathering” will feature over 40 purveyors of art, games, toys, comics, collectables, and all things odd, geeky, bizarre, imaginative, and wonderful. Oddmall’s presence in June marks the first in a series of market partners scheduled to appear each month.

Kenmore First Fridays will take place every first Friday of the month beginning June 3 and will continue through Sept. 2. The free events will run from 6 to 9 p.m. and will feature live music, vendors, family activities, food trucks and an outdoor beer garden with a rotating cast of breweries that include HiHo Brewing Company, Lock 15 Brewing Company and Thirsty Dog Brewing Co. “This year, we’re celebrating the fifth anniversary of our Kenmore Better Block event, which really kick-started our community’s revitalization efforts,” said Tina Boyes, executive director of Kenmore Neighborhood Alliance. “Since then, we’ve added more than $1.5 million in new investment, an historic district and 12 new businesses along Kenmore Boulevard, many of which support our budding music economy. And the growth can be attributable in part to events like Kenmore First Friday. So, this year we’re bringing in bigger bands, adding a new street stage, and partnering with well-known market partners to celebrate that and encourage people to come back.”
